Hi Dave

We used RG6 (Belden 1829A) cables with F connectors for most of our 80M and 
160M antennas at the ZL6QH Quartz Hill station. We had no problems running 
the NZ legal limit (500W) into these feed line systems.

I think I saw someone talk about using RG-6 75 ohm coax at a full KW
and F connectors on 160, but I cannot remember if it was on this
reflector. I have some "high Quality" RG-6 cable with the "right" vp,
but before trying this I would like to hear from someone who has
successfully done this already.
